Asbestos, a naturally occurring mineral, was valued for its strength, properties that prevented fire and its low cost. It was used in a multitude of products throughout the 20th century, particularly after WWII, when production grew as wartime demands grew. The fibers are poisonous and have been linked with a variety of illnesses including lung cancer, asbestosis, and mesothelioma.

Making the Right Compensation

An attorney can assist you in the event that you or a family member has developed mesothelioma, or lung cancer following being exposed to asbestos. A successful claim could pay for medical bills, lost wages, out-of pocket expenses, pain and discomfort, and other losses.

An experienced asbestos lawyer can determine the most suitable state to file a lawsuit and will make sure your lawsuit is filed in time, so you do not miss out on the money you deserve. In some states, the statute of limitation is only a couple of years.

In addition to filing a person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it against the asbestos companies that caused the exposure you suffered, you could be eligible to receive compensation from trust funds or the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). Your lawyer can help you understand your legal options and give you the best advice about what to pursue.

Compensation for mesothelioma through a lawsuit or VA claim and also the compensation from trust funds and lawsuits may help victims cover costs for treatment and other expenses. It is also meant to create a sense of accountability and justice to those responsible for asbestos exposure.
